SMP9317 - Nonvolatile DACPOT Electronic Potentiometer With Up/Down Counter Interface

Features

  • Digitally Controlled Electronic Potentiometer.
  • 7-Bit Digital-to-Analog Converter (DAC).
  • Independent Reference Inputs.
  • Differential Non-Linearity - +0.5LSB.
  • Integral Non-Linearity - +1LSB.
  • VOUT Value in EEPROM for Power-On Recall.
  • Equivalent to 128-Step Potentiometer.
  • Unity Gain Op Amp Drives ±100µA.
  • Simple Trimming Adjustment.
  • Up/Down Counter Style Operation.
  • Low Noise Operation.

SUMMIT MICROELECTRONICS, Inc. SMP9317 Nonvolatile DACPOT™ Electronic Potentiometer With Up/Down Counter Interface FEATURES • Digitally Controlled Electronic Potentiometer • 7-Bit Digital-to-Analog Converter (DAC) – Independent Reference Inputs – Differential Non-Linearity - +0.5LSB – Integral Non-Linearity - +1LSB • VOUT Value in EEPROM for Power-On Recall – Equivalent to 128-Step Potentiometer • Unity Gain Op Amp Drives ±100µA • Simple Trimming Adjustment – Up/Down Counter Style Operation • Low Noise Operation • “Clickless” Transitions between DAC Steps • No Mechanical Wearout Problem – 1,000,000 Stores (typical) – 100 Year Data Retention • Operation from +2.7V to +5.5V Supply • Ultra-Low Power, 0.
